SAN DIEGO – Isaiah Pineiro recorded his seventh double-double in the past eight games but it was not enough to help San Diego overcome a poor night of shooting as the Toreros fell 66-46 to Saint Mary's on Saturday night at the Jenny Craig Pavilion.
Pineiro led USD (17-12, 6-8 WCC) with 13 points and 14 rebounds for his 13th double-double of the season.

USD struggled all night offensively, shooting just 29 percent (15-51) from the field and 5-of-18 (28 percent) from 3-point range. Carter III chipped in 12 points and Wright added 10.
The Toreros did not have an answer for the Gaels (19-10, 10-4 WCC) Jordan Ford who scored a game-high 21 points. The Gaels finished strong offensively, shooting 54 percent in the second half and finishing at 46 percent from the field on the night.
Saint Mary's dominated the boards with a 43-30 advantage in rebounds, including 11 on the offensive end. The Gaels outscored the Toreros 36-16 in points in the paint.
USD will look to bounce back next week when it concludes the regular season at San Francisco and BYU.
